Kerala, often called “God’s Own Country,” is a tropical paradise on India’s southwestern coast. From serene backwaters to misty hill stations, spice plantations to pristine beaches, Kerala enchants every traveler.
Why Visit Kerala?
- Backwaters: Cruise through Alleppey’s emerald waterways on a luxury houseboat
- Hill Stations: Munnar’s rolling tea gardens and Wayanad’s misty forests
- Ayurveda: World-renowned Ayurvedic spas and wellness retreats
- Wildlife: Periyar Tiger Reserve — elephants, bison, and rare birds
- Cuisine: Fresh seafood, appam with stew, and traditional Sadya feast
Best Time to Visit
September to March offers the best weather. Monsoon (June-August) is ideal for Ayurvedic treatments.
